diff --git a/docs/engine.io-protocol/v3-test-suite/package-lock.json b/docs/engine.io-protocol/v3-test-suite/package-lock.json index c71d1da045..965a39b12e 100644 --- a/docs/engine.io-protocol/v3-test-suite/package-lock.json +++ b/docs/engine.io-protocol/v3-test-suite/package-lock.json @@ -13,7 +13,7 @@ "mocha": "^9.2.1", "node-fetch": "^3.2.0", "prettier": "^2.5.1", - "ws": "^8.5.0" + "ws": "^8.20.0" } }, "node_modules/@ungap/promise-all-settled": { @@ -1067,16 +1067,17 @@ "dev": true }, "node_modules/ws": { - "version": "8.5.0",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z", - "integrity": "s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"dev": true, + "license": "MIT", "engines": { "node": ">=10.0.0" }, "peerDependencies": { "bufferutil": "^4.0.1", - "utf-8-validate": "^5.0.2" + "utf-8-validate": ">=5.0.2" }, "peerDependenciesMeta": { "bufferutil": { @@ -1881,9 +1882,9 @@ "dev": true }, "ws": { - "version": "8.5.0",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z", - "integrity": "s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"dev": true, "requires": {} }, diff --git a/docs/engine.io-protocol/v3-test-suite/package.json b/docs/engine.io-protocol/v3-test-suite/package.json index 0f46351b4f..b56cc6f748 100644 --- a/docs/engine.io-protocol/v3-test-suite/package.json +++ b/docs/engine.io-protocol/v3-test-suite/package.json @@ -13,6 +13,6 @@ "mocha": "^9.2.1", "node-fetch": "^3.2.0", "prettier": "^2.5.1", - "ws": "^8.5.0" + "ws": "^8.20.0" } } diff --git a/docs/engine.io-protocol/v4-test-suite/package-lock.json b/docs/engine.io-protocol/v4-test-suite/package-lock.json index c71d1da045..965a39b12e 100644 --- a/docs/engine.io-protocol/v4-test-suite/package-lock.json +++ b/docs/engine.io-protocol/v4-test-suite/package-lock.json @@ -13,7 +13,7 @@ "mocha": "^9.2.1", "node-fetch": "^3.2.0", "prettier": "^2.5.1", - "ws": "^8.5.0" + "ws": "^8.20.0" } }, "node_modules/@ungap/promise-all-settled": { @@ -1067,16 +1067,17 @@ "dev": true }, "node_modules/ws": { - "version": "8.5.0",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z", - "integrity": "s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"dev": true, + "license": "MIT", "engines": { "node": ">=10.0.0" }, "peerDependencies": { "bufferutil": "^4.0.1", - "utf-8-validate": "^5.0.2" + "utf-8-validate": ">=5.0.2" }, "peerDependenciesMeta": { "bufferutil": { @@ -1881,9 +1882,9 @@ "dev": true }, "ws": { - "version": "8.5.0",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z", - "integrity": "s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"dev": true, "requires": {} }, diff --git a/docs/engine.io-protocol/v4-test-suite/package.json b/docs/engine.io-protocol/v4-test-suite/package.json index 0f46351b4f..b56cc6f748 100644 --- a/docs/engine.io-protocol/v4-test-suite/package.json +++ b/docs/engine.io-protocol/v4-test-suite/package.json @@ -13,6 +13,6 @@ "mocha": "^9.2.1", "node-fetch": "^3.2.0", "prettier": "^2.5.1", - "ws": "^8.5.0" + "ws": "^8.20.0" } } diff --git a/docs/socket.io-protocol/v5-test-suite/package-lock.json b/docs/socket.io-protocol/v5-test-suite/package-lock.json index aa088643d0..1160541405 100644 --- a/docs/socket.io-protocol/v5-test-suite/package-lock.json +++ b/docs/socket.io-protocol/v5-test-suite/package-lock.json @@ -13,7 +13,7 @@ "mocha": "^9.2.1", "node-fetch": "^3.2.0", "prettier": "^2.5.1", - "ws": "^8.5.0" + "ws": "^8.20.0" } }, "node_modules/@ungap/promise-all-settled": { @@ -1067,16 +1067,17 @@ "dev": true }, "node_modules/ws": { - "version": "8.5.0",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z", - "integrity": "s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"dev": true, + "license": "MIT", "engines": { "node": ">=10.0.0" }, "peerDependencies": { "bufferutil": "^4.0.1", - "utf-8-validate": "^5.0.2" + "utf-8-validate": ">=5.0.2" }, "peerDependenciesMeta": { "bufferutil": { @@ -1881,9 +1882,9 @@ "dev": true }, "ws": { - "version": "8.5.0",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.5.0.tgz", - "integrity": "sha512-BWX0SWVgLPzYwF8lTzEy1egjhS4S4OEAHfsO8o65WOVsrnSRGaSiUaa9e0ggGlkMTtBlmOpEXiie9RUcBO86qg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"dev": true, "requires": {} }, diff --git a/docs/socket.io-protocol/v5-test-suite/package.json b/docs/socket.io-protocol/v5-test-suite/package.json index 6b0391bccd..b3f996b529 100644 --- a/docs/socket.io-protocol/v5-test-suite/package.json +++ b/docs/socket.io-protocol/v5-test-suite/package.json @@ -13,6 +13,6 @@ "mocha": "^9.2.1", "node-fetch": "^3.2.0", "prettier": "^2.5.1", - "ws": "^8.5.0" + "ws": "^8.20.0" } } diff --git a/examples/basic-websocket-client/package.json b/examples/basic-websocket-client/package.json index 4094b8fd5d..5bc1225537 100644 --- a/examples/basic-websocket-client/package.json +++ b/examples/basic-websocket-client/package.json @@ -7,7 +7,7 @@ "prettier": "^2.8.4", "rollup": "^3.20.2", "socket.io": "^4.6.1", - "ws": "^8.18.3" + "ws": "^8.20.0" }, "scripts": { "bundle": "rollup -c", diff --git a/package-lock.json b/package-lock.json index 6cd7d0b48a..14534d37f2 100644 --- a/package-lock.json +++ b/package-lock.json @@ -15801,9 +15801,9 @@ } }, "node_modules/ws": { - "version": "8.18.3", - "resolved": "https://registry.npmjs.org/ws/-/ws-8.18.3.tgz", - "integrity": "sha512-PEIGCY5tSlUt50cqyMXfCzX+oOPqN0vuGqWzbcJ2xvnkzkq46oOpz7dQaTDBdfICb4N14+GARUDw2XV2N4tvzg==", + "version": "8.20.0", + "resolved": "https://registry.npmjs.org/ws/-/ws-8.20.0.tgz", + "integrity": "sha512-sAt8BhgNbzCtgGbt2OxmpuryO63ZoDk/sqaB/znQm94T4fCEsy/yV+7CdC1kJhOU9lboAEU7R3kquuycDoibVA==", "license": "MIT", "engines": { "node": ">=10.0.0" @@ -16037,7 +16037,7 @@ } }, "packages/engine.io": { - "version": "6.6.5", + "version": "6.6.6", "license": "MIT", "dependencies": { "@types/cors": "^2.8.12", @@ -16049,7 +16049,7 @@ "cors": "~2.8.5", "debug": "~4.4.1", "engine.io-parser": "~5.2.1", - "ws": "~8.18.3" + "ws": "~8.20.0" }, "engines": { "node": ">=10.2.0" @@ -16062,7 +16062,7 @@ "@socket.io/component-emitter": "~3.1.0", "debug": "~4.4.1", "engine.io-parser": "~5.2.1", - "ws": "~8.18.3", + "ws": "~8.20.0", "xmlhttprequest-ssl": "~2.1.1" } }, @@ -16102,7 +16102,7 @@ "license": "MIT", "dependencies": { "debug": "~4.4.1", - "ws": "~8.18.3" + "ws": "~8.20.0" } }, "packages/socket.io-client": { @@ -16164,7 +16164,7 @@ "license": "MIT" }, "packages/socket.io-parser": { - "version": "4.2.5", + "version": "4.2.6", "license": "MIT", "dependencies": { "@socket.io/component-emitter": "~3.1.0", diff --git a/package.json b/package.json index 065f60d875..8c1475d53b 100644 --- a/package.json +++ b/package.json @@ -18,7 +18,7 @@ "overrides": { "@types/estree": "0.0.52", "@types/lodash": "4.14.189", - "ws": "8.18.3" + "ws": "8.20.0" }, "devDependencies": { "@babel/core": "^7.24.7", diff --git a/packages/engine.io-client/package.json b/packages/engine.io-client/package.json index 197aa40605..be1865a43f 100644 --- a/packages/engine.io-client/package.json +++ b/packages/engine.io-client/package.json @@ -55,7 +55,7 @@ "@socket.io/component-emitter": "~3.1.0", "debug": "~4.4.1", "engine.io-parser": "~5.2.1", - "ws": "~8.18.3", + "ws": "~8.20.0", "xmlhttprequest-ssl": "~2.1.1" }, "scripts": { diff --git a/packages/engine.io/package.json b/packages/engine.io/package.json index 5aa3912183..05dab80e03 100644 --- a/packages/engine.io/package.json +++ b/packages/engine.io/package.json @@ -40,7 +40,7 @@ "cors": "~2.8.5", "debug": "~4.4.1", "engine.io-parser": "~5.2.1", - "ws": "~8.18.3" + "ws": "~8.20.0" }, "scripts": { "compile": "rimraf ./build && tsc", diff --git a/packages/socket.io-adapter/package.json b/packages/socket.io-adapter/package.json index 021206ac69..d6f927569e 100644 --- a/packages/socket.io-adapter/package.json +++ b/packages/socket.io-adapter/package.json @@ -18,7 +18,7 @@ "description": "default socket.io in-memory adapter", "dependencies": { "debug": "~4.4.1", - "ws": "~8.18.3" + "ws": "~8.20.0" }, "scripts": { "compile": "rimraf ./dist && tsc",